    Musclecontest Pro Bikini Preview & Winner Poll
    Isaac Hinds


    Unless things change in the next couple of days, we will see 15 women strutting their stuff in the first IFBB Pro Bikini show held in the US.



    The first Pro Bikini show was held last weekend in New Zealand with Sonia Gonzales taking top honors. No disrespect to her and the others but when the field is only three deep it is tough to gauge of what the division will become.

    Many feel Sonia is what the standard in bikini should be while others think she carries too much muscle. It’s hard to say until we see all the women stand on stage next to each other. There’s no denying Sonia is a beautiful woman but one look at the roster and she’s in good company. It will take more than a pretty face to win this show. She is one of a few women making the transition from Figure to Bikini at this event.

    Sherlyn Roy competed in the Figure International and had a lackluster showing placing 17th. She competed in the Figure Olympia last year but I feel the bikini division will suit her physique better. She’ll try her hand at bikini this weekend.

    Zhanna Rotar is also making the transition from Figure to Bikini for this event. Zhanna will definitely bring the sex appeal and presentation to the stage but will she be carrying too much muscle for the judges liking? We’ll have to see but she’s definitely toned down her muscle since her competitive Figure days.

    Dianna Dahlgren has been blowing up the fitness modeling scene in the last few months. She only has three shows under her belt but has a look that many women and men are drawn to. She won’t have the same amount of muscle as many of the other women on stage but it could work to her advantage. It all depends on what look the judges are after with the new division.

    Amanda Latona is no stranger to the competitive stage and has a near flawless presentation. Fit booty fans will go wild when she takes the stage as she has some badunka dunk. It’s definitely not a bad thing. A stunning woman who undoubtedly will be a top contender, or at least many feel she should (myself included).

    Monique “Momo” Minton will present her best physique to date at this show. We got a little preview at the Arnold Classic and she’s on point. If she’s able to present her physique in a confident manner she should be another one turning heads and making the judges do a double take.

    Stacey Thompson was one of the first bikini pros and has been working like a woman possessed to streamline her physique since that show. She carried a good deal of muscle when winning but from recent photos it looks like she’ll be presenting a completely different physique and one of the names to listen for in the top callouts.

    Alea Suarez has a great physique and wasted no time in getting in the mix since turning pro at the NPC Nationals last fall. This Texas beauty has a chance to do well at this show but again it will all depend on what the judges are after.

    My sleeper pick to shake things up in the show is Leigh Lingham. She’ll be making the trip down from Canada to compete at this show. I had the chance to meet Leigh at the Arnold Classic and she is a doll. I really like her look and if she can rock it on stage I can easily see her doing well at this show. She hasn’t seen a whole lot of love yet in the States but keep your eye on her. She’s one to watch.

    Michelle D’Angona, Jennifer Dietrick, Michele Gullet, Carol King, Christie Marquez and Natalie Pennington will all have their work cut out for them to crack the top five at this show. It’s no knock on them but it is a testament of how deep the field is for this show. Natalie is already qualified for the Bikini Olympia with her second place finish at the New Zealand Pro so the pressure if off her coming into this contest.
